| #include <assert.h>
 | |
| #include <ctype.h>
 | |
| #include <string.h>
 | |
| #include <strings.h>
 | |
| 
 | |
| extern "C" {
 | |
| 
 | |
| void bzero(void* dest, size_t n)
 | |
| {
 | |
|     memset(dest, 0, n);
 | |
| }
 | |
| 
 | |
| void bcopy(const void* src, void* dest, size_t n)
 | |
| {
 | |
|     memmove(dest, src, n);
 | |
| }
 | |
| 
 | |
| static char foldcase(char ch)
 | |
| {
 | |
|     if (isalpha(ch))
 | |
|         return tolower(ch);
 | |
|     return ch;
 | |
| }
 | |
| 
 | |
| int strcasecmp(const char* s1, const char* s2)
 | |
| {
 | |
|     for (; foldcase(*s1) == foldcase(*s2); ++s1, ++s2) {
 | |
|         if (*s1 == 0)
 | |
|             return 0;
 | |
|     }
 | |
|     return foldcase(*(const unsigned char*)s1) < foldcase(*(const unsigned char*)s2) ? -1 : 1;
 | |
| }
 | |
| 
 | |
| int strncasecmp(const char* s1, const char* s2, size_t n)
 | |
| {
 | |
|     if (!n)
 | |
|         return 0;
 | |
|     do {
 | |
|         if (foldcase(*s1) != foldcase(*s2++))
 | |
|             return foldcase(*(const unsigned char*)s1) - foldcase(*(const unsigned char*)--s2);
 | |
|         if (*s1++ == 0)
 | |
|             break;
 | |
|     } while (--n);
 | |
|     return 0;
 | |
| }
 | |
| }
